In today's online landscape, robust computer protection is paramount. A single weakness can expose your sensitive information to malicious entities. To safeguard your networks, it's crucial to implement a multi-layered approach that encompasses the latest methods.
- Utilize strong passwords and multi-factor authentication.
- Regularly update your software and operating environments.
- Install a reputable antivirus program and keep it current.
- Remain aware of phishing emails.
- Secure your data both in transit and at rest.
By following these best practices, you can significantly minimize the risk of a breach and protect your valuable digital assets.

Protecting Your PC: Windows 11 Defender vs. Alternatives
Navigating the realm of cybersecurity can be a daunting task, especially with the plethora of antivirus and security solutions available. When it comes to Windows 11, users often question whether built-in protection like Windows Defender is sufficient or if they need to invest in third-party options. This article aims to shed light on the strengths and weaknesses of Windows Defender compared to leading competitors, empowering you to make an informed choice for your security needs.
Windows Defender has evolved significantly over the years, boasting real-time protection against malware, ransomware, and phishing threats. Its cloud-based intelligence helps identify emerging threats quickly, providing a robust layer of defense against evolving cyberattacks. However, some users may find its features fundamental compared to more comprehensive security suites that offer additional capabilities, such as firewall management, parental controls, and password managers.
- Some antivirus programs like Norton, McAfee, and Bitdefender often provide a broader selection of features and advanced security. These suites may offer real-time threat scanning, behavior monitoring, vulnerability assessments, and even VPN services.
- Choosing the right security solution ultimately depends on your individual demands and budget. If you're looking for a no-frills, reliable option with basic protection, Windows Defender can be a solid choice.
- On the other hand, if you need more advanced features, want peace of mind knowing your system is comprehensively protected, or require additional tools like parental controls or a VPN, investing in a third-party security suite may be worthwhile.
